Title :
A continuous tunable source of coherent UV radiation

Abstract :
We describe a continuous tunable ultraviolet radiation source, operating in the spectral range 290-315 nm by intracavity frequency doubling of a rhodamine 6G dye laser. Maximum intracavity second-harmonic power of 1.1 mW was obtained at 296 nm with a bandwidth of 0.1 nm.
